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6219314719 60056 633871 1995 6938673012
428254 8387243460 70826741144
428254 8387243460 70826741144
11 3565209277 977749020 835642 23
All about undefined
Interested in learning more?
428254 8387243460 70826741144
11 3565209277 977749020 835642 23
See more
8693787285 95555841 8023227
60 511716723 98
See more
3461 2976 65465994815
327756 503271181 73036581560
See more